焦 陽 賈偉娜
(鄭州升達經貿管理學院信息工程系,河南 鄭州 451191)
?
民辦高校關于“(雙語版)Java程序設計”的研究
焦陽賈偉娜
(鄭州升達經貿管理學院信息工程系,河南鄭州451191)
摘要:本文提出了民辦高校計算機專業中《Java程序設計》課程雙語教學的必要性,分析了當前民辦高校實施Java雙語教學所存在的問題,提出了提高雙語教學課程效果的一些建議。
關鍵詞:民辦高校;Java程序設計;雙語
計算機作為21世紀的領先學科,又起源于歐美,技術領先在歐美,將計算機專業中《Java程序設計》這門課選為雙語授課模式益處頗多。其一,該課程作為一門程序設計課程,其語言代碼、開發工具中本身就包含很多英語單詞。其二,Java語言最早由美國Sun Microsystems公司開發,其很多資源都是英文版的,通過雙語的學習,有助于學生進一步學習和提高技術,使從事Java編程的人員能夠掌握最新的技術[1]。其三,近幾年中國的軟件外包行業發展迅猛,市場上需要即精通編程又精通英語的編程人員。但是在民辦高校中,因受各方面因素的影響,雙語教學的質量并不理想。學生的英語基礎薄弱,教師的教學水平不高,傳統的雙語教學方法不適用于三本層次的民辦高校學生等,諸多因素都成為開展雙語教學的絆腳石。
“雙語教學”是高等院校培養高層次專業技術人才的一種新模式,優點有四。第一,提高學生閱讀外文專業技術文獻的能力,特別是計算機這類起源于歐美的學科,很多著名的學術論著都是英文版,翻譯的版本一來時效性不強,二來不能完全體現原著的精髓[2];在信息全球化進程不斷快速發展的背景下,雙語教學已成為更直接、更迅速、更有效的傳載前沿知識信息的重要教學手段。第二,培養學生可以從網絡或其他渠道獲得優秀的教學資源的能力,學生將來從事科研打下堅實基礎,比如維基百科、谷歌學術等網站,很多好的資料和文章都是英文的。第三,提高學生的專業外語水平的,開闊學生的專業知識視野,從而提高學生在就業市場上的競爭力。目前就業市場需要大量既精通專業知識又具備較高外語水平的復合型人才。第四,開展雙語教學對教師自身要求較高,一旦勝任,教學相長,也可提高教師的計算機專業教學水平。
民辦高校辦學歷史短,在辦學經驗、師資隊伍素質、資金及教學設施等方面,與一本院校和二本院校存在一定差距。另外,民辦高校招生的層次是三本學生,生源質量也低于一本和二本院校。同時,由于近年來發展步伐太快,很多民辦高校在編制課程體系時過多沿用學術型本科專業的課程體系,缺乏自身特點[3]。
2.1計算機專業雙語教學師資力量的匱乏
民辦高校在辦學條件和教職工的薪資待遇上不如公辦高校,因此很難吸引優秀的人才。有些青年教師即便在民辦高校工作,軍心也不穩,很多教師在評了中高級職稱之后,一有機會仍然想進公辦院校。這樣的現象導致民辦高校的師資相對薄弱,具備雙語教學能力的教師更是少之又少,無法形成穩定的教學團隊。
2.2學生自身外語水平參差不齊
在計算機專業課程中采用雙語教學,使得大部分學生一時間難以適應。民辦高校屬于三本院校,很多生源來自于各省的縣級地區或是農村,學生英語的聽說程度較低,如果課堂上采用全程英語授課的話,學生會對雙語可產生畏懼心理,久而久之影響教學效果。
2.3缺乏適合民辦高校學生的雙語教材
目前市面上的雙語教材種類非常少,一本二本的公辦院校采用英文原版教材居多。這類教材大多數書本很厚,內容多而深,不適合作為中國學生的教材,作為參考資料比較合適。民辦高校的學生英文程度本來就不如一本二本的公辦高校,學習原版教材極為吃力。
3.1制定合理的教學目標
制定合理的教學目標可以使教學過程更有針對性,目的性更強。對于民辦高校學生來說,學習理論的能力較弱,英語基礎薄弱,想讓這些學生在雙語課上用外語理解來精學一門技術,難度很大。教學目標不宜制定過高,過高會讓學生認為課程太難而喪失學習的動力。因此,筆者設定的教學目標是學生能夠掌握關鍵的英文詞匯,能看懂技術相關文檔,在此基礎上能夠按照英文題目的要求正確寫出代碼就很好。如果再高一點的目標就是,學生能夠熟練使用Java語言進行編程。
3.2提高師資水平
民辦高校在師資力量薄弱的情況下,應當鼓勵現有教師承擔雙語課程。由于雙語課程比專業課程要付出更多的時間和精力,學校應適當提高雙語課的課時系數。學校應該給本校教師提供在崗繼續培訓或深造的機會,比如短期的出國培訓,或國內知名學府的假期培訓。另外,聘請優秀資深的兼職雙語教師,讓本校教師觀摩學習,也可以起到培養自身教師的作用。
3.3選擇合適的雙語教材
好的教材,可以減輕老師的備課負擔,避免老師在教學進度安排、教案講稿的準備以及課件的制作上花費大量的時間,從而將更多的精力放在更好地安排和組織課堂上的各個教學環節,提升課堂效率,以及課下對學生編程作業的輔導,總結學生學習的難點,花更多時間分析和講解學生在編程過程中遇到的問題,最終才能更好地達到這門課的教學目標。
目前,Java雙語類的教材并不是很多。一本的院校甚至直接用英文原版書來進行講解,如美國作者Bruce Eckel的《Thinking in Java》[1]和美國Deitel父子合著的《Ja?va How to Program》,這兩本書都是學習Java的經典書籍,但是對于民辦高校的學生來說,難度太大,太深奧且價格昂貴。筆者選用的教材是電子工業出版社出版的《雙語版Java程序設計》,章節精簡共14章,內容以英語為主,部分核心內容有中文釋義,每章有課后習題及編程練習題,難度適中,較適合民辦高校的學生學習,使用該教材的學生反映較好。
3.4選擇合適的教學方法
在教學過程中,對于英語基礎薄弱的民辦高校的學生,筆者選擇了在教學初期以中文教學為主,用英語對關鍵的技術和專業術語做解釋說明的教學方法。在做每節課后的習題都使用英文題目,讓學生通過翻譯題目、討論題目,更好地了解題目要義,最終完成練習,逐步建立對學好這門課的信心。隨著學生不斷地適應,慢慢地提高英語授課的比例,最終達到良好的教學效果。
3.5培養學生自主學習的能力
教與學的過程即相互獨立,又密不可分。不管教師采用各種手段在“教”上下功夫,學生如果不學,也同樣得不到好的結果。培養學生自主學習的能力,對于《雙語JAVA語言程序設計》這門課程來說,也尤為重要。興趣是最好的老師。在課堂上,通過具體的案例來讓學生切身體會Java工具的好處,讓學生對這門課產生興趣。課下將學生進行分組,每次作業以小組為單位進行比賽,全組平均成績最好的勝出,加以獎勵,帶動學生的積極性,組員之間相互學習,以強帶弱。這種方法在筆者所教的班級中效果十分顯著。
總之,Java程序設計課程十分適合雙語教學。對于民本高校的學生,只要擁有優良的師資、優質的教材、對學生施以合適的教學方法,就能達到良好的教學效果。
參考文獻:
[1]王玉英.《Java語言程序設計》雙語教學實踐與探討[J].現代計算機,2009(9):83-85.
[2]符曉四,趙永禮.計算機專業雙語教學的探索與實踐[J].巢湖學院學報,2010(6):145-148.
[3]焦陽,呂麗平.河南省民辦高校電子信息工程專業人才培養模式探討——以鄭州升達經貿管理學院信息工程系為例[J].黃河科技大學學報,2013(4):11-13.
中圖分類號:TP312.2
文獻標識碼:A
文章編號:1003-5168(2016)01-0068-02
收稿日期:2015-12-30
基金項目:鄭州升達經貿管理學院創辦人科研基金2014年校級課題“民辦高校關于‘(雙語版)Java程序設計’課程的教學探討”(43)。
作者簡介:焦陽(1985-),女,碩士,講師,研究方向:圖像處理和計算機應用。
Research on"(Bilingual Edition)Java Programming"In Private Colleges
Jiao YangJia Weina
(Department of Information Engineering,Shengda Economics Trade&Management College of Zhengzhou,Zhengzhou Henan 451191)
Abstract:This paper presented the necessity of bilingual teaching for"Java programming"course in computer spe?cialty of private colleges,analyzed the existing problems of implementing Java bilingual teaching in private colleges, and putted forward some suggestions on how to improve the teaching effects in bilingual.
Keywords:private college;programming in Java;bilingual